This lecture is part of my Berkeley math 115 course "Introduction to number theory"
For the other lectures in the course see youtube.com/playlist?list=PL8yHsr3EFj53L8sMbzIhhXSAOpuZ1Fov8
We give some more examples of numerical algorithms, such as as algorithm to find square roots of -1, and a factoring algorithm, and a prime testing algorithm that works on some Carmichael numbers.
The textbook is "An introduction to the theory of numbers" by Niven, Zuckerman, and Montgomery (5th edition).
